What is Microblading/Nanoblading?
Microblading is semi-permanent eyebrow enhancement technique using manual handheld tool with ultra-fine needles arranged in blade configuration. Artist creates individual hair-like strokes depositing pigment into upper dermal layer, mimicking natural brow hairs for realistic appearance. Unlike tattooing (permanent, deeper, uses machine), microblading semi-permanent (1-2 years), superficial (fades naturally), manual control (precision, delicate strokes). Ideal for sparse brows, over-plucked areas, asymmetry correction, complete brow reconstruction, enhancing natural shape.
Nanoblading advancement of microblading—uses even finer single needle (vs blade with multiple needles) creating thinner, crisper individual strokes. Results more refined, hyper-realistic, suitable for all skin types including oily (where traditional microblading may blur). Process involves consultation designing custom shape, color selection matching hair/skin tone, numbing for comfort, meticulous stroke-by-stroke application creating natural pattern. Results immediate but heal over 4-6 weeks as pigment settles. Touch-up 6-8 weeks after perfecting shape, color. Maintenance annual or biannual refresh sustaining appearance. Understanding the techniques
Traditional manual blade technique with multiple ultra-fine needles creating hair-stroke effect. Slightly thicker strokes, suitable for most skin types, beautiful natural results. Original semi-permanent brow method, widely available, established technique.
Advanced refinement using single ultra-fine needle creating thinner, crisper individual strokes. Hyper-realistic results, superior for oily skin (less blur), more precise, delicate appearance. Newer technique requiring specialized training.

Minimal discomfort with proper numbing. Topical anesthetic cream applied 20-30 minutes before reduces pain significantly. With numbing: most rate 2-3 on 10-point scale, brief scratching/pressure sensation. Without numbing would be 5-7 (not recommended). Sensation: light scratching, tweezing feeling, mild pressure. Not sharp pain. Some areas more sensitive than others (inner brow toward nose slightly more tender). Individual pain tolerance varies but overwhelming majority find it very tolerable. Secondary numbing gel applied during procedure if needed. Breaks offered anytime. Post-procedure: slight tenderness 1-2 days similar to mild sunburn, easily managed. Most describe as “not as bad as expected,” “totally worth minor discomfort for results.” Compared to eyebrow threading/waxing: comparable or less painful. Much less than tattoo (superficial vs deep). Anxiety often worse than actual experience. Deep breathing, chatting with artist helps distraction.
Typical duration 12-24 months before significant fading, averaging 18 months. Individual variation based on: skin type (oily skin faster fade 12-15 months, dry skin longer retention 18-24 months), sun exposure (UV breaks down pigment faster), skincare products (acids, retinoids, vitamin C accelerate fading), immune system (faster cell turnover quicker fade), aftercare compliance (proper healing improves longevity), lifestyle (swimming, sweating frequent causes faster loss). Fading gradual, graceful—lightens evenly over time not patchy. By 18-24 months most ready for refresh maintaining shape. Not permanent like traditional tattoo—pigment placed superficially, body naturally metabolizes over time. This advantage: can adjust shape, color, style as trends/preferences change. Touch-up protocol: 6-8 weeks post-initial perfecting result, annual or biannual refresh (color boost, shape refinement) maintaining indefinitely. Some extend to every 2 years if retention excellent. Refresh sessions quicker, less expensive than initial. Flexibility adjusting design over years as face/style evolves.
Significant differences: Technique: Microblading manual handheld tool, artist controls each stroke. Tattoo uses electric machine. Depth: Microblading superficial (upper dermis), tattoo deeper (mid-deep dermis). Permanence: Microblading semi-permanent 1-2 years fading naturally, tattoo permanent (or very long-lasting requiring laser removal). Results: Microblading creates hair-stroke effect mimicking natural brows. Tattoo typically solid fill block color (less natural unless powder/ombre technique). Pigment: Microblading uses specialized semi-permanent pigments designed to fade gracefully. Tattoo ink permanent, may turn blue/green over time (old permanent makeup issue). Pain: Microblading gentler, superficial. Tattoo more painful, deeper penetration. Healing: Microblading 4-6 weeks, tattoo 6-8 weeks. Flexibility: Microblading allows design evolution as trends change. Tattoo commitment permanent. Cost: Microblading requires ongoing maintenance every 1-2 years. Tattoo one-time but can’t easily change. Modern permanent makeup (PMU) evolved—some techniques like powder brows, ombre brows use machine but superficial pigment similar concept to microblading longevity.
Ideal candidates: sparse, thin, over-plucked brows, asymmetric brows needing balance, gaps from scarring, alopecia, medical hair loss, desire for fuller, defined brows without daily makeup, active lifestyle (swimming, gym) wanting waterproof brows, mature clients with thinning brows. Not suitable candidates: pregnancy/breastfeeding (hormones affect pigment retention, safety precaution), active skin conditions on brows (eczema, psoriasis, dermatitis), keloid scarring tendency, blood clotting disorders or anticoagulants, chemotherapy/radiation (compromised healing), Accutane use (must wait 6-12 months after stopping), very oily skin (nanoblading better option), unrealistic expectations (cannot create brows from nothing if no follicles), unwilling to commit to aftercare, touch-up. Relative contraindications: diabetes (healing may be slower, infection risk higher—controlled diabetes okay with precautions), autoimmune conditions (healing unpredictable, consult doctor), very sensitive skin (patch test essential). Age: no strict limit but skin quality matters—mature thin skin may not retain pigment well, very young clients (under 18) require parental consent, realistic maturity. Consultation determines suitability individual basis.
Pricing varies by artist experience, location, technique: Initial microblading session (includes touch-up 6-8 weeks later): ₹15,000-35,000 typical range. Entry-level/new artists: ₹12,000-18,000. Experienced certified artists: ₹20,000-30,000. Master artists, specialized clinics: ₹25,000-40,000. Nanoblading (advanced technique): ₹25,000-45,000 initial. Touch-up sessions (6-8 weeks post-initial): Usually included in initial price. If separate: ₹5,000-10,000. Annual refresh/color boost (12-18 months later): ₹8,000-20,000 depending on work needed. Biannual maintenance: ₹8,000-15,000. Multi-year investment: Year 1: ₹15,000-35,000 (initial plus perfecting touch-up). Year 2: ₹8,000-20,000 (annual refresh). Year 3-5: ₹8,000-20,000 annually or biannually. Why variation: artist skill, training certifications, sterile environment, pigment quality, time investment (2-3 hours initial), consultation, design, aftercare products included. Red flags: extremely cheap (under ₹10,000)—likely inexperienced, poor quality pigments, inadequate sterility. Investment in experienced artist worthwhile—face is not place for bargain hunting. Results depend on artistry, technique precision. Research artist portfolio, reviews, certifications before committing.
Proper aftercare critical for optimal healing, pigment retention: First 10 days (most crucial): Keep brows completely dry—no water, swimming, excessive sweating, steam (sauna, hot showers). Apply thin layer healing ointment (provided) 2-3 times daily with clean hands. Do NOT over-apply (too much prevents skin breathing, causes poor healing). Absolutely NO picking, scratching, or peeling scabs (causes pigment loss, scarring). Sleep on back avoiding pillow friction on brows. No makeup on brows. No sun exposure, tanning beds. Avoid gym, strenuous exercise first week. No facials, chemical peels, Anti-wrinkle near brows 4 weeks. Days 10-28: Can wash brows gently after day 10, pat dry. Avoid harsh cleansers, exfoliants directly on brows. Still no picking if any residual flaking. Sun protection important (hat or SPF once fully healed week 4+). Long-term maintenance: Daily SPF on brows when in sun (prolongs pigment). Avoid chemical exfoliants (retinoids, AHAs, BHAs) directly on brows. No permanent makeup removers, laser treatments near brows. Avoid excessive chlorine (swimming pools). Touch-up 6-8 weeks non-negotiable for best results. Common mistakes ruining results: getting brows wet first week, picking scabs, over-applying ointment suffocating skin, using wrong products, skipping touch-up. Following instructions precisely ensures beautiful, long-lasting outcome.
